Inhaltsverzeichnis
Einführung
Überprüfung des Grundwissens
Kernkonzept oder Funktionsanalyse
Die Definition und Funktion von phpMyadmin
Wie es funktioniert
Beispiel für die Nutzung
Grundnutzung
Erweiterte Verwendung
Häufige Fehler und Debugging -Tipps
Leistungsoptimierung und Best Practices
Heim Datenbank phpMyAdmin PhpMyAdmins Funktion: Interaktion mit MySQL (SQL)

PhpMyAdmins Funktion: Interaktion mit MySQL (SQL)

May 07, 2025 am 12:16 AM
mysql php

PHPMYADMIN vereinfacht die MySQL -Datenbankverwaltung über die Weboberfläche. 1) Datenbanken und Tabellen erstellen: Verwenden Sie die grafische Schnittstelle, um einfach zu bedienen. 2) Führen Sie komplexe Abfragen aus: wie die von SQL Editor implementierte Join -Abfrage. 3) Optimierung und Best Practices: einschließlich SQL -Abfrageoptimierung, Indexverwaltung und Datensicherung.

Einführung

In der modernen Webentwicklung ist das Datenbankmanagement ein unverzichtbarer Teil, und MySQL als eine der beliebtesten Open -Source -Datenbanken wird häufig von Entwicklern bevorzugt. Die Verwaltung von MySQL -Datenbanken ist jedoch nicht immer so intuitiv und einfach, und PhpMyAdmin ist zu diesem Zeitpunkt nützlich. PHPMYADMIN ist ein kostenloses Open -Source -Tool, das eine bequeme Möglichkeit bietet, MySQL -Datenbanken über die Weboberfläche zu verwalten. In diesem Artikel werden die interaktiven Funktionen von PhpMyadmin und MySQL (SQL) eingehend untersucht, um dieses leistungsstarke Tool besser zu verstehen und zu nutzen.

Durch das Lesen dieses Artikels erfahren Sie, wie Sie PHPMYADMIN für grundlegende Datenbankoperationen verwenden, über seine erweiterten Funktionen erfahren und Ihren Datenbankmanagementprozess in realen Projekten optimieren.

Überprüfung des Grundwissens

Bevor wir uns mit PhpMyadmin eintauchen, lasst uns die Grundlagen von MySQL und SQL überprüfen. MySQL ist ein relationales Datenbankverwaltungssystem (RDBMS), das SQL (Structured Query Language) zum Verwalten und Manipulieren von Daten verwendet. SQL ist eine Standard -Datenbank -Abfragesprache, die zum Erstellen, Ändern und Abfragen von Datenbanken verwendet wird.

PHPMYADMIN ist ein webbasiertes Tool, das über den Browser eine grafische Benutzeroberfläche (GUI) bietet, mit der Benutzer intuitiver MySQL-Datenbanken verwalten können. Es unterstützt fast alle MySQL -Funktionen, einschließlich Datenbankerstellung, Tabellenverwaltung, SQL -Abfrageausführung usw.

Kernkonzept oder Funktionsanalyse

Die Definition und Funktion von phpMyadmin

PHPMYADMIN ist eine Open -Source -Webanwendung, mit der MySQL -Datenbanken über einen Browser verwaltet wurden. Benutzer können verschiedene Datenbankvorgänge ausführen, z. B. das Erstellen von Datenbanken, das Verwalten von Tabellenstrukturen, das Ausführen von SQL-Abfragen, das Importieren und Exportieren von Daten usw. Mit seiner Hauptfunktion können Sie den Managementprozess von MySQL-Datenbanken vereinfachen, sodass auch Benutzer ohne eingehende Datenbankwissen problemlos funktionieren können.

Wie es funktioniert

PHPMYADMIN läuft über einen Webserver wie Apache oder Nginx und interagiert mit der MySQL -Datenbank über PHP -Skripte. Wenn ein Benutzer über einen Browser auf PhpMyAdmin zugreift, übergibt der Webserver die Anforderung an die PHP -Skripte, die mit der MySQL -Datenbank kommunizieren, entsprechende Vorgänge ausführen und die Ergebnisse an den Benutzer zurückgeben.

Unten verwendet PhpMyAdmin die API von MySQL, um SQL -Abfragen auszuführen und Datenbanken zu verwalten. Es wandelt die Operationen des Benutzers in entsprechende SQL -Anweisungen um und führt diese Anweisungen über die Verbindung von MySQL aus. PHPMYADMIN bietet auch viele bequeme Funktionen, wie z. B. SQL Query -Generator, Datenexporttool usw. Diese Funktionen werden über PHP -Skripte implementiert.

Beispiel für die Nutzung

Grundnutzung

Schauen wir uns ein einfaches Beispiel an, das zeigt, wie eine neue Datenbank und Tabelle mit PhpMyAdmin erstellt werden.

 // Erstellen Sie eine neue Datenbank erstellen Sie Datenbank MyDatabase;

// Verwenden Sie die neu erstellte Datenbank verwenden Sie MyDatabase.

// Erstellen einer neuen Tabelle erstellen Sie Tabellen Benutzer (Benutzer erstellen
    ID int auto_increment Primärschlüssel,
    Benutzername Varchar (50) Nicht null,
    E -Mail Varchar (100) NICHT NULL
);
Nach dem Login kopieren

In PHPMYADMIN können Sie diese Operationen problemlos über eine grafische Schnittstelle durchführen. Klicken Sie auf die Schaltfläche "Neu", um eine Datenbank zu erstellen, dann eine Tabelle in der Datenbank zu erstellen und die Feldinformationen der Tabelle auszufüllen.

Erweiterte Verwendung

PHPMYADMIN unterstützt auch viele erweiterte Funktionen, z.

 // Angenommen, wir haben zwei Tabellen: Benutzer und Bestellungen
Wählen Sie Benutzer
Von Benutzern
Innere Beiträge für Benutzer.id = Bestellungen.User_id
Wo ordnungen.order_date> '2023-01-01';
Nach dem Login kopieren

In PHPMYADMIN können Sie diese Abfrage mit dem SQL Query Editor eingeben und ausführen. PHPMYADMIN Zeigt die Abfrageergebnisse an und bietet verschiedene Optionen zum Exportieren oder Weiterverarbeiten dieser Daten.

Häufige Fehler und Debugging -Tipps

Bei Verwendung von PHPMYADMIN können Sie auf einige häufige Probleme stoßen, wie z.

  • SQL -Syntaxfehler : Überprüfen Sie, ob Ihre SQL -Anweisung korrekt ist, und stellen Sie sicher, dass alle Schlüsselwörter und Zeichensetzung korrekt sind. PHPMYADMIN wird Syntaxfehler hervorheben, um Probleme schnell zu finden.
  • Berechtigungen Ausgabe : Stellen Sie sicher, dass Sie über genügend Berechtigungen verfügen, um die erforderlichen Maßnahmen auszuführen. Wenn Sie auf Erlaubnisprobleme stoßen, können Sie die Benutzerberechtigungen über die Benutzerverwaltungsfunktion von PHPMYADMIN anpassen.
  • Probleme mit Datenimport- und Exportproblemen : Stellen Sie beim Importieren oder Exportieren von Daten sicher, dass das Dateiformat korrekt ist und die Zeichencodierung konsistent ist. Wenn Sie auf Probleme stoßen, können Sie versuchen, unterschiedliche Import- und Exportoptionen zu verwenden, oder prüfen, ob die Datendatei beschädigt ist.

Leistungsoptimierung und Best Practices

Es gibt verschiedene Möglichkeiten, die Leistung zu optimieren und die Effizienz bei der Verwaltung von MySQL -Datenbanken mithilfe von PHPMYADMIN zu verbessern:

  • Optimieren Sie die SQL -Abfrage : Verwenden Sie die Erklärung Anweisung, um den Abfrageausführungsplan zu analysieren und mögliche Leistungs Engpässe zu finden. Vermeiden Sie die Verwendung von Select * und wählen Sie nur die gewünschten Felder aus.
  • Indexoptimierung : Das Erstellen von Indizes für häufig abgefragte Felder kann die Abfragegeschwindigkeit erheblich verbessern. PHPMYADMIN bietet Indexverwaltungsfunktionen, um Ihnen die Erstellung und Verwaltung von Indizes zu erleichtern.
  • Datensicherung und Wiederherstellung : Es ist sehr wichtig, die Datenbank regelmäßig zu sichern. PHPMYADMIN bietet eine bequeme Datenexportfunktion und ermöglicht eine einfache Sicherung von Datenbanken. Verwenden Sie bei der Wiederherstellung von Daten die richtigen Importoptionen, um Datenbeschädigungen zu vermeiden.

In den tatsächlichen Projekten gibt es einige Best Practices, die es wert sind, bei der Verwendung von PHPMYADMIN zu beachten:

  • Sicherheit : Stellen Sie sicher, dass die Installation und Konfiguration von PHPMYADMIN sicher ist, und vermeiden Sie die Bekämpfung öffentlicher Netzwerke. Verwenden Sie starke Kennwörter und aktualisieren Sie die PhpMyAdmin -Version regelmäßig, um Sicherheitslücken zu entfachen.
  • Lesbarkeit der Code : Halten Sie die Code -Lesbarkeit und -struktur beim Schreiben von SQL -Abfragen. Verwenden Sie Kommentare und angemessene Einrückung, um Fragen zu verstehen und zu warten.
  • Versionskontrolle : Die Einbeziehung der Datenbankstruktur und SQL -Abfragen in das Versionskontrollsystem kann den Verlauf der Datenbankänderung besser verwalten und die Teamzusammenarbeit erleichtern.

Durch das Lernen und die Praxis des oben genannten Inhalts können Sie PHPMYADMIN effizienter verwenden, um MySQL -Datenbanken zu verwalten und Ihre Entwicklungseffizienz und die Projektqualität zu verbessern.

Das obige ist der detaillierte Inhalt vonPhpMyAdmins Funktion: Interaktion mit MySQL (SQL).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Heiße KI -Werkzeuge

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Clothoff.io

Clothoff.io

KI-Kleiderentferner

Video Face Swap

Video Face Swap

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heiße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

Java-Tutorial
1662
14
PHP-Tutorial
1262
29
C#-Tutorial
1236
24
MySQL und PhpMyAdmin: Kernfunktionen und Funktionen MySQL und PhpMyAdmin: Kernfunktionen und Funktionen Apr 22, 2025 am 12:12 AM

MySQL und PhpMyAdmin sind leistungsstarke Datenbankverwaltungs -Tools. 1) MySQL wird verwendet, um Datenbanken und Tabellen zu erstellen und DML- und SQL -Abfragen auszuführen. 2) PHPMYADMIN bietet eine intuitive Schnittstelle für Datenbankverwaltung, Tabellenstrukturverwaltung, Datenoperationen und Benutzerberechtigungsverwaltung.

Die Kompatibilität von IIS und PHP: ein tiefer Tauchgang Die Kompatibilität von IIS und PHP: ein tiefer Tauchgang Apr 22, 2025 am 12:01 AM

IIS und PHP sind kompatibel und werden durch FASTCGI implementiert. 1.Iis leitet die .php -Dateianforderung über die Konfigurationsdatei an das FastCGI -Modul weiter. 2. Das FastCGI -Modul startet den PHP -Prozess, um Anforderungen zur Verbesserung der Leistung und Stabilität zu verarbeiten. 3. In den tatsächlichen Anwendungen müssen Sie auf Konfigurationsdetails, Fehlerdebuggen und Leistungsoptimierung achten.

Erklären Sie den Zweck von Fremdschlüssel in MySQL. Erklären Sie den Zweck von Fremdschlüssel in MySQL. Apr 25, 2025 am 12:17 AM

In MySQL besteht die Funktion von Fremdschlüssel darin, die Beziehung zwischen Tabellen herzustellen und die Konsistenz und Integrität der Daten zu gewährleisten. Fremdeschlüssel behalten die Wirksamkeit von Daten durch Referenzintegritätsprüfungen und Kaskadierungsvorgänge bei. Achten Sie auf die Leistungsoptimierung und vermeiden Sie bei der Verwendung häufige Fehler.

Vergleichen und kontrastieren Sie MySQL und Mariadb. Vergleichen und kontrastieren Sie MySQL und Mariadb. Apr 26, 2025 am 12:08 AM

Der Hauptunterschied zwischen MySQL und Mariadb ist Leistung, Funktionalität und Lizenz: 1. MySQL wird von Oracle entwickelt und Mariadb ist seine Gabel. 2. Mariadb kann in Umgebungen mit hoher Last besser abschneiden. 3.MariADB bietet mehr Speichermotoren und Funktionen. 4.Mysql nimmt eine doppelte Lizenz an, und Mariadb ist vollständig Open Source. Die vorhandene Infrastruktur, Leistungsanforderungen, funktionale Anforderungen und Lizenzkosten sollten bei der Auswahl berücksichtigt werden.

Wie kann ich JavaScript -Objekte, die Funktionen und reguläre Ausdrücke in einer Datenbank und wiederherstellen, sicher speichern? Wie kann ich JavaScript -Objekte, die Funktionen und reguläre Ausdrücke in einer Datenbank und wiederherstellen, sicher speichern? Apr 19, 2025 pm 11:09 PM

Mit sicheren Funktionen und regulären Ausdrücken in JSON in der Front-End-Entwicklung ist JavaScript häufig erforderlich ...

SQL gegen MySQL: Klärung der Beziehung zwischen den beiden SQL gegen MySQL: Klärung der Beziehung zwischen den beiden Apr 24, 2025 am 12:02 AM

SQL ist eine Standardsprache für die Verwaltung von relationalen Datenbanken, während MySQL ein Datenbankverwaltungssystem ist, das SQL verwendet. SQL definiert Möglichkeiten, mit einer Datenbank zu interagieren, einschließlich CRUD -Operationen, während MySQL den SQL -Standard implementiert und zusätzliche Funktionen wie gespeicherte Prozeduren und Auslöser bereitstellt.

Was passiert, wenn Session_Start () mehrmals aufgerufen wird? Was passiert, wenn Session_Start () mehrmals aufgerufen wird? Apr 25, 2025 am 12:06 AM

Mehrere Anrufe bei Session_Start () führen zu Warnmeldungen und möglichen Datenüberschreibungen. 1) PHP wird eine Warnung ausstellen und veranlassen, dass die Sitzung gestartet wurde. 2) Dies kann zu unerwarteten Überschreibungen von Sitzungsdaten führen. 3) Verwenden Sie Session_Status (), um den Sitzungsstatus zu überprüfen, um wiederholte Anrufe zu vermeiden.

Wie unterscheidet sich MySQL von Oracle? Wie unterscheidet sich MySQL von Oracle? Apr 22, 2025 pm 05:57 PM

MySQL eignet sich für schnelle Entwicklung und kleine und mittelgroße Anwendungen, während Oracle für große Unternehmen und hohe Verfügbarkeitsanforderungen geeignet ist. 1) MySQL ist Open Source und einfach zu bedienen, geeignet für Webanwendungen und kleine und mittelgroße Unternehmen. 2) Oracle ist mächtig und für große Unternehmen und Regierungsbehörden geeignet. 3) MySQL unterstützt eine Vielzahl von Speichermotoren, und Oracle bietet reichhaltige Funktionen auf Unternehmensebene.

See all articles